Output ec5deb334a119bd5260281d0b42a84b7e10813617c8acf9009f2c3d459f87ed5:5

value
437630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cd7035a9e865732224a0cb555ee0a69ee9f49a0 OP_EQUALVERIFY OP_CHECKSIG
address
16Yh7tA7yYN67p2VnKobTt4aLpbENnwBDP
transaction
ec5deb334a119bd5260281d0b42a84b7e10813617c8acf9009f2c3d459f87ed5
spent
true